I was wondoring what all has to be done and purchased to instal a turbo. I have the actual turbo, no hoses though.

If it's a single turbo youll need a ton of stuff about 1800-2500 dollars worth.
headers wastegate, downpipe, intake tubing , lines, blow off valve intercooler, new exhaust, your turbo should be at least a T66 for single or two t3s youll need bigger injectors, new engine management, big fuel, pump, wide band o2 sensor, and a bunch of stuff I forgot. In my opinion a turbo is too mutch money unless you have an engine built for it. If your car is pretty mutch stock, Id just go with n20 500 dollars and a fuel pump , you can spray a 150 to 200 shot. 200 is a bit mutch but it will take it. Anyway 600 bucks for n20, or 3000 for a turbo you have to set at 9psi max. |
